Вимкнення та ввімкнення блоків у VEXcode 123

VEXcode 123 дозволяє користувачам вимикати та вмикати блоки у своїх проектах. Це корисна функція для студентів під час тестування або налагодження проекту, тому їм не потрібно розбирати проект, щоб з’ясувати, що не працює належним чином. Користувач може вимкнути або ввімкнути блок(и), щоб протестувати та спостерігати за відмінностями в поведінці робота, коли цей блок є чи ні в проекті.


Як відключити і включити блокування

VEXcode 123 Блокує проект із відкритим контекстним меню ввімкненого блоку та виділеним параметром «Вимкнути блок». Праворуч показано результат із вибраним блоком, який тепер виділено сірим кольором, що означає, що його вимкнено.

Щоб скористатися функцією вимкнення або ввімкнення блоків у VEXcode 123, робот 123 має бути підключений до вашого планшета чи комп’ютера.

Вимкнення блоку не дозволить йому виконуватися під час запуску проекту. Щоб вимкнути блок, клацніть правою кнопкою миші або утримуйте його, щоб активувати контекстне меню, а потім виберіть «Вимкнути блок». Потім у проекті блок відображатиметься сірим із сіткою діагональних ліній над ним.

VEXcode 123 Блокує проект із відкритим контекстним меню вимкненого блоку та виділеною опцією «Увімкнути блок». Праворуч знаходиться той самий проект, але вибраний блок тепер має колір, який вказує на те, що його ввімкнено.

Щоб увімкнути блок, щоб він виконувався під час запуску проекту, клацніть правою кнопкою миші або утримуйте вимкнений блок, щоб активувати контекстне меню, а потім виберіть Увімкнути блок.


Що відбувається з окремими блоками при вимкненні

VEXcode 123 Блокує проект, що містить вимкнений блок. Блок виділено сірим кольором і має сітку з діагональних ліній.

Коли блок(и) вимкнено, він відображається сірим із сіткою діагональних ліній над ним.

Вимкнений блок розглядається як коментар. Це не впливає на хід проекту та не буде виконано під час запуску проекту.

У наведеному вище прикладі робот 123 поїде вперед на 1 крок, а потім зупиниться; не повернеться.


Що відбувається, коли блоки з вкладеними блоками вимкнено

Проект VEXcode 123 Blocks із відкритим контекстним меню увімкненого контейнерного блоку та виділеним параметром «Вимкнути блок».

Коли ви вимикаєте блок, у якому є вкладені блоки, усі блоки вимикаються. Блоки, такі як цикл або умова if-then-else, які мають вкладені блоки, можна вимкнути так само, як і один блок.

Клацніть правою кнопкою миші або утримуйте, щоб активувати контекстне меню цього циклу або умовного блоку керування, а потім виберіть Вимкнути блок.

VEXcode 123 Блокує проект із вимкненим блоком-контейнером і всіма його вкладеними блоками. Блоки виділені сірим кольором і мають сітку з діагональних ліній.

На зображенні показано, що відбувається, коли цикл повторення вимкнено. Петля та два блоки всередині неї були вимкнені, і всі вони виглядають сірими з сіткою діагональних ліній на них.

Проект VEXcode 123 Blocks із відкритим контекстним меню вимкненого контейнерного блоку та виділеною опцією «Увімкнути блок».

У цьому прикладі нічого не станеться під час запуску проекту, оскільки всі блоки вимкнено. Ви можете ввімкнути головний блок і всі вкладені блоки в ньому, активувавши контекстне меню головного блоку та вибравши Увімкнути блок.

VEXcode 123 Блокує проект із увімкненим блоком-контейнером і всіма його вкладеними блоками.

Коли основний блок увімкнено, усі вкладені блоки в ньому також будуть увімкнені.

У цьому прикладі, коли основний блок увімкнено, коли проект розпочато, робот 123 поїде вперед на 1 крок, потім поверне праворуч на 90 градусів і повторить ці дії 4 рази, щоб проїхати по квадрату.


Вимкнення та ввімкнення окремого вкладеного блоку

VEXcode 123 Проект блоків із відкритим контекстним меню увімкненого блоку. Блок вкладено всередину блоку-контейнера, а параметр «Вимкнути блок» виділено. Праворуч показано результат, вибраний блок тепер вимкнено.

Ви можете вимкнути один блок у серії вкладених блоків, як-от цикл або умовний оператор if-then-else, виконавши ті самі кроки, що й для будь-якого іншого блоку: клацніть правою кнопкою миші або утримуйте, щоб активувати контекстне меню цього блоку та вибрати Вимкнути блокування.

У цьому прикладі один блок у циклі вимкнено.

VEXcode 123 Блокує проект із відкритим контекстним меню вимкненого блоку. Блок вкладено всередину блоку-контейнера, а параметр «Увімкнути блок» виділено. Праворуч показано результат із увімкненим вибраним блоком.

Щоб увімкнути цей вкладений блок, вам потрібно клацнути правою кнопкою миші або довго натиснути, щоб активувати його контекстне меню.

Проект VEXcode 123 Blocks із відкритим контекстним меню контейнерного блоку та опцією «Увімкнути блок» виділено, але сірим. Один із його вкладених блоків вимкнено, але параметр «Увімкнути блок» недоступний, оскільки сам блок-контейнер усе ще ввімкнено.

Зауважте, що контекстне меню для головного блоку (у цьому випадку блоку [Повторити]) не забезпечить опцію для ввімкнення вкладеного блоку, оскільки сам головний блок не було вимкнено.

For more information, help, and tips, check out the many resources at VEX Professional Development Plus

Last Updated: